The French Minister of Justice arrives in Algiers…await the translation of words into action!

Algeria News Portal:French Minister of Justice Gérald Darmanin arrived in Algeria alongside a group of judges, and was greeted at Houari Boumediene International Airport by the Algerian Minister of Justice, Lotfi Boujemaa.

According to the French Ministry of Justice, the French Minister of Justice’s itinerary is of considerable importance to Algeria and includes conversations about judicial cooperation among the various French and Algerian authorities, in addition to discussions about other, more “sensitive” topics.

According to the French Ministry of Justice, a further objective of this trip is to renew relations concerning judicial cooperation between Paris and Algeria.

Likewise, according to the French Ministry of Justice, consultations between both parties that involve other “important” subjects are scheduled to include: the fight against organized crime; the fight against drug trafficking; the fight against terrorism; the crime of trafficking and transiting across borders; financial crime and the monitoring of the so-called “dirty money”.

In relation to the diplomatic niceties of the visit, and in the presence of the media, the French Minister of Justice will also be called upon to answer, in a clear and unambiguous manner, Algerian demands, and to turn good faith gestures and expressions into acts, and to abandon the policies of haste and two-pronged approaches to the core of the issues that have long strained Algerian-French relations. These include the retrieval of stolen assets, the fulfillment of judicial requests, and the extradition of accused persons to Algeria

President Tebboune Directs Strict Measures to Curb Import Bill and Boost Domestic Production

ALGIERS— In a decisive move to safeguard national financial reserves and foster economic self-reliance, Algerian President Abdelmadjid Tebboune has issued a series of executive directives aimed at drastically reducing the country’s import bill.
The instructions, delivered during the latest Council of Ministers meeting, underscore a strategic shift towards prioritizing local manufacturing and restricting the influx of non-essential foreign goods. President Tebboune emphasized that lowering import dependency is not merely a fiscal necessity, but a cornerstone of Algeria’s economic sovereignty.

Key Directives Issued by the Presidency:

  • Rationalization of Imports: The President ordered a rigorous review of import licenses, mandates, and quotas, ensuring that foreign procurement is strictly confined to essential goods and raw materials that cannot currently be sourced domestically.
  • Empowering Local Industries: Government sectors have been instructed to provide unparalleled support to national manufacturers, SMEs, and startups to fill the supply gaps in the domestic market.
  • Combating Invoicing Fraud: Tightened regulatory oversight and stricter customs auditing will be implemented to counter over-invoicing practices, which have historically drained foreign currency reserves.
  • Inter-Sectoral Coordination: A mandate was established for closer cooperation between the Ministry of Commerce, the Ministry of Industry, and financial institutions to streamline the transition toward import substitution.
    Economic analysts view these directives as an accelerated push toward structural economic reforms. By tightening control over foreign expenditures, the Algerian government aims to stimulate domestic investment, generate sustainable employment opportunities, and build a more resilient, diversified economy capable of withstanding global market fluctuations.

El Mouradia Palace: President Tebboune chairs a Council of Ministers meeting

Today, Sunday, Algerian President Abdelmadjid Tebboune, Supreme Commander of the Armed Forces and Minister of National Defense, is chairing a Council of Ministers meeting. According to the Algerian Presidency, the agenda includes presentations on the national strategy for developing the petrochemical industry to produce raw materials, and monitoring the progress of sheep imports in preparation for the blessed Eid al-Adha. Furthermore, the meeting will follow up on the progress of the Bled El Hadba mining railway line and the Annaba Port expansion projects, alongside reviewing the status of the Algerian Water Company (Algérienne des Eaux) and overall water management.

Five drug traffickers arrested and 100 kg of cannabis seized in the west of the country.

Algeria News Portal: Members of the Algerian Gendarmerie’s regional unit in Sidi Bel Abbès, in the country’s western Second Military Region, have arrested five people and seized more than 100 kg and 68 kg of processed cannabis from a lorry, according to a statement from the Algerian Ministry of Defence.

Joint detachments of the People’s National Army in the Bechar military sector, in the third military region, also seized a significant quantity of hallucinogenic tablets, estimated at 238,506 tablets of the type Pregabalin 300 mg, according to the same source.

The statement adds that this comes as part of the fight against organised crime and is a continuation of the targeted operations carried out by units of the People’s National Army in the fight against smuggling barons and drug traffickers, thanks to the optimal use of intelligence.

These operations also serve to reaffirm the commitment of all components of the People’s National Army to countering any attempts aimed at undermining the security and safety of citizens.
